    Do you have an affiliate sign up portal on your website?

    Many successful vendors have a page where affiliates can enter their ID, get a personalized affiliate link, and access resources like email swipes and graphics.

    Also you should have a bit of a mini salesletter explaining why your offer is great and overwhelm them with oodles of proof.

    This would include screenshots of your PPC/Analytics dashboards and/or video proof logins into your vendor account showing sales and proving that your offer is converting.

    Also testimonials from successful affiliates if available.

    If you don't have any of this yet, you need to focus on increasing your offer's conversion rate through optimization and testing.

    Document everything for proof and maybe a nice case study that you can use to attract even more affiliates.

    After that, you need to market your affiliate program.

    An easy way to do that is to post it on popular internet marketing forums like this one and the others out there.

    If you don't know where they are Google is your friend.

    If you have a digital product you should probably list it on Clickbank or JVZoo because those websites have databases of thousands of affiliates looking for hot offers to promote.

    A word of warning, don't just skip to the marketing part.

    Make sure your house is in order and you've got proof your offer converts otherwise promoting it won't lead to very many new affiliates signing up.

    The easiest way to attract affiliates is for you to do something for them first. When I first started out I would reach out to the affiliates and ask them if I could do anything to help them first. I would offer to promote them first and wouldn't even bring up my own offer. They would just naturally offer to promote me after I had already done something for them. Read the book or audiobook "How to win friends and influence people". Always think about what you can do for others first.

    A lot of people who have their own program, what they do is when they get new customers, they offer their affiliate program in the back office.

    So even customers are given the option to join their affiliate program.

    People have done this for YEARS.

    This is no underground secret.

    As an affiliate myself... I would say case studies. Yes! For instance a detailed case study about how one of your affiliates was able to do really good numbers with offers from your affiliate network.

    Then you can be able to pitch your affiliate network's selling points, be it bi-weekly payments, higher than usual CPA/CPS et cetera...

    Hi, two of the keys to attracting more affiliates are the profitability and popularity of the product that you have. If you have a quick payment term or good campaigns with a high payout and CR, that will help you attract more affiliates to your program.
